Bancpost inks RON 20 mln loan guarantee deal with EximBank

Bancpost and EximBank have concluded a new partnership to support local entrepreneurship, allowing companies an easier access to financing instruments for their current activity, as well as the achievement of investment projects. By signing the SMEs Securing Ceiling Agreement, a large number of SMEs that don’t have enough assets to cover the guarantees, can benefit from the Bancpost lending solutions. The guarantee ceiling made available to Bancpost amounts to RON 20 million and is dedicated to securing loans in RON granted by the bank to its clients.

Clients can benefit from individual guarantees worth maximum RON 1.5 million. For investment projects, the individual guarantee can cover up to 80 percent of the principal value. To support the current activity, clients can access guarantees of up to 70 percent of the credit line value, facility which can be annually renewed.

“We know that one of the main concerns of entrepreneurs related to the financing needs for their business is to identify eligible guarantees for the bank. The natural consequence is this partnership between Bancpost and EximBank, which opens new opportunities for entrepreneurs which can get, at the right moment, the amounts they need to accomplish their investment plans or to finance their current activity. Worth mentioning is the state initiative to involve two big players on counter guarantees market for loans granted to SME clients in a market context in which it is so important to finance this sector,” said Dragos Calin, executive manager, Bancpost.

“We also intend to replicate this with other commercial banks, to the net benefit of entrepreneurs”, said Traian Halalai, executive president of EximBank.
